Resources are very scarce around the United States. Identify one scarce resource and analyze the impact of the scarcity of that resource on an economy. What is one solution that the government can provide to ensure that the scarcity will not be impacted as much?

There is a growing demand for electric and solar vehicles and also products that use these as energy resources. They work on batteries made up largely from lithium. Lithium batteries are way more efficient than lead acid batteries.

Mobile phones and other battery operated instruments also has high demand for lithium. USA does not have enough working resources. From 2014 to 2018 the imports have doubled to around 4000 metric tons of lithium.

Solution to this is identify mines and start working immediately to reduce import bill. Alternative finding like magnesium, mercury and zinc. Like USA did for crude oil, finding cost effective way of mining lithium is also a solution.
